Servecentric Connects Directly to Cognet 6-18-2008 |
Servecentric, the data centre managed services company, today announced that it has attracted Cogent Communications - one of the world's largest capacity IP network providers - to connect its fibre directly into Servecentric's Dublin centre. |

Cogent's high performance multi-national Tier 1 network carries over 17% of the
world's Internet traffic. Cogent's investment significantly raises Ireland's
rating as a location for multi-national Internet companies. Servecentric is its
only Irish data centre. Cogent's cost effective fibre network will
provide Servecentric customers with the ability to have almost limitless
multiple Gigabit expansion opportunities. Cogent is consistently ranked
as one of the world's top five Internet providers and currently takes its 80 -
200 Gbps backbone network and connects it to over 100 metro markets throughout
North America and Europe. The network connects Servecentric to Manchester and
Servecentric to London, meaning that it is very secure, with no single point of
failure. Companies that depend on micro-second connections between
end-users and the core Internet applications are a key target for the new
service. These include online trading, gaming, and voice and video over Internet
services, where end-users want to minimise time-wasting network hops. Cogent, as
a tier 1 Internet network ensures best quality and fewest possible hops from
network-to-network. Among the seventeen carriers connecting to the
Servecentric data centre, Cogent has been selected as one of only three
providers whom any client can access via Servecentric's core internet mesh.

reacts faster than the human reflex." About
Servecentric Servecentric is a wholly owned, private funded, Irish
organisation. It was established in August 2002 and has its headquarters in
Blanchardstown Corporate Park in Dublin. It is currently Ireland's leading
managed services and data centre operator and provides high-quality, scaleable
solutions from single cabinet collocation services to full-scale provision of
managed services. About Cogent Cogent Communications (NASDAQ:
CCOI) is a multinational, Tier 1 facilities-based ISP, operating one of the
largest capacity IP networks in the world with lit capacities ranging from 80 to
200 Gigabits per second. Cogent specializes in providing businesses with high
speed Internet access and point-to-point transport services. Cogent's
facilities-based, all-optical IP network backbone provides IP services in over
100 markets located in North America and Europe. Since Cogent's
inception, Cogent has unleashed the benefits of IP technology, building one of
the largest and highest capacity IP networks in existence. This network enables
Cogent to offer large bandwidth connections at highly competitive prices. Cogent
Communications is headquartered at 1015 31st Street, NW, Washington, D.C. 20007.
